Quality Assessment

As of 11 September 2026, Cummins India Ltd. maintains an excellent quality grade. The company demonstrates robust long-term fundamental strength, highlighted by an average Return on Equity (ROE) of 23.75%. This reflects efficient capital utilisation and consistent profitability. Additionally, the firm has sustained healthy growth rates, with net sales expanding at an annualised rate of 20.17% and operating profit growing at 31.76% over the long term. Importantly, the company is net-debt free, which enhances its financial stability and reduces risk exposure.

Valuation Considerations

Despite the strong quality metrics, the valuation grade for Cummins India Ltd. is currently assessed as very expensive. The stock trades at a Price to Book Value (P/BV) of 16.8, significantly above the average valuations of its peers. This premium reflects investor confidence but also implies limited upside potential at current price levels. The company’s ROE of 28.6% supports a high valuation, yet the Price/Earnings to Growth (PEG) ratio stands at 4, indicating that earnings growth may not fully justify the elevated price. Investors should be cautious about the premium paid relative to earnings growth prospects.

Financial Trend Analysis

The financial trend for Cummins India Ltd. is currently flat. The latest quarterly results ending June 2026 show some softness, with PBDIT at Rs 616.16 crore—the lowest in recent quarters—and operating profit to net sales ratio dropping to 17.98%, also a recent low. While the company has delivered consistent returns over the past three years, including a 24.79% return over the last year and a 13.73% gain year-to-date, the recent flatness in operating performance suggests a pause in momentum. Profit growth over the past year was 14.5%, which, while positive, is moderate compared to historical trends.

Sector and Market Context

Cummins India Ltd. operates within the Compressors, Pumps & Diesel Engines sector, a segment that is sensitive to industrial cycles and infrastructure spending. The company’s large-cap status and net-debt-free balance sheet position it favourably against peers, especially in times of economic uncertainty. However, the sector’s capital-intensive nature and cyclical demand patterns mean that valuation premiums must be justified by sustained earnings growth and operational efficiency.
